Sri Lanka’s Wild Cookbook Star Charith N. Silva Shines on Forbes 30 Under 30 List

Charith N. Silva, the creator behind Sri Lanka’s most popular YouTube channel Wild Cookbook, has earned a prestigious spot on the Forbes 30 Under 30 Asia list under the Art category, shining a global spotlight on Sri Lankan creativity and resilience.

Known for his captivating videos showcasing traditional and modern dishes prepared in breathtaking outdoor locations, Silva launched Wild Cookbook in 2020 amid the challenges of the pandemic. What began as a humble passion project has grown into a cultural phenomenon—amassing over 10 million YouTube subscribers and 2.3 million Instagram followers.

His journey is a powerful reminder of how authenticity, innovation, and a deep connection to nature can capture hearts around the world. With more than 600 videos under his belt, Silva has become not just a digital creator, but a storyteller of Sri Lankan culinary heritage.

In November 2024, he expanded his brand beyond the screen, opening a rustic-themed restaurant in Colombo named Wildish, bringing the wild cooking experience into an urban setting.
